Linux基础命令【rpm/yum包命令】【常用的管理命令】【第三篇】

软件包管理(安装)

.rpm --使用(有很强的依赖关系)

rpm -qa --查看系统已经安装的rpm 包

rpm -ivh "包名"-安装

rpm -e "包名"--卸载 --有依赖关系,也逐步删除

rpm -e --nodeps "包名" --强力删除,有依赖关系强制删除

rpm -ga | grep zlih --查看zlih的包

rpm -gf /etc/ntp.conf --查看文件属于那个安装包

yum 原来管理rpm管理

/etc/yum.repos.d : 配置yum仓库文件(通过DNS解析)

gpgcheck = 1 是否开启校验

mirrors.163.com

mirrors.sohu.com

yum list --列出所有可以(已安装)的包

@ :表示已经安装

安装软件包 yum -y install '包名'

卸载软件包 yum -y remove '包名'

DNS解析

常用的系统管理命令

ifconfig --查看系统的ip信息

top --查看系统整体资源(windows资源管理器)

htop - 查看系统整体资源(windows资源管理器)

free -m --从看看内存以M为单位来看

netstat [-anltup] --产看端口情况

losf -i:8080 ---查看当前端口的占用情况

netstat -an --查看端口监听是否开启

netstat -tlnp --t:TCP协议;l:监听

Linux基础命令【rpm/yum包命令】【常用的管理命令】【第三篇】

ps --查看进程

Linux基础命令【rpm/yum包命令】【常用的管理命令】【第三篇】

ps -ef

ps -auxf

kill --杀死进程

kill -l --理出放出信号的进程

kill 2243(PID)(默认-15) --普通杀出进程(程序中有关联程序)

kill -9 2243 --强制删除进程/

whoami -- 查看当前用户